Message
Sharp spiritual sight unveils divine purpose, ignites faith and provides direction on the path of destiny. Spiritual blindness prevents one from seeing the truth, consequently leading to deception, complacency and destruction. In our text this morning, Jesus advised the Laodicean Church to anoint their eyes so that they could see clearly. An ointment was recommended, an “eye salve.” It is a balm used to heal the eyes of any lump or bulge that causes blurry vision or blindness. God is teaching us wisdom this day that we should apply spiritual ointment on our spiritual eyes so that we can see clearly and move in the right direction. This ointment comes through the Holy Spirit who enlightens our hearts, gives us discernment and empowers us to embrace righteousness and walk in God’s will.
If we miss this Holy Spirit-empowered ointment, we might not experience the fullness of God’s given abilities available to us. Today, seek God’s anointing, ask for revelation and clarity of purpose. Let His word be the eye salve that sharpens your vision, quickening you to discern the truth.
